Disability shower installation services involve customizing bathroom showers to meet the specific needs of individuals with mobility challenges or physical disabilities. These services typically include the installation of accessible features such as low-threshold or curbless showers, grab bars, seating options, and non-slip flooring. The goal is to create a safer and more functional bathing environment that accommodates users with varying levels of mobility, helping to promote independence and ease of use within the bathroom space.
These installations address common problems faced by individuals with disabilities or limited mobility, such as difficulty stepping over high thresholds, maintaining balance, or safely using traditional shower setups. By modifying or replacing existing showers with accessible designs, these services help reduce the risk of slips, falls, and other accidents. Additionally, they can alleviate the physical strain on caregivers and family members by making bathing routines easier and more manageable for those with mobility restrictions.

The overview below groups typical Disability Shower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in La Habra,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Installation Costs - The cost for installing a disability shower typically ranges from $1,500 to $5,000, depending on the complexity and materials used. Basic models may be on the lower end, while custom features can increase the price. Local service providers can offer detailed quotes based on specific needs.
Material Expenses - The price of shower materials varies from $300 to $1,500, with options like accessible tiles, low-threshold bases, and grab bars influencing costs. Higher-end finishes and specialized fixtures tend to raise overall expenses. Contact local pros for material recommendations and pricing estimates.
Additional Features - Optional features such as seating, hand-held shower heads, or anti-slip flooring can add $200 to $1,000 to the total cost. The inclusion of these features depends on individual accessibility requirements and preferences. Local contractors can provide guidance on feature options and associated costs.
Labor Charges - Labor costs for installing a disability shower usually range from $800 to $2,500, influenced by the project's scope and existing bathroom conditions. Complex installations or modifications may increase labor expenses. Reach out to local service providers for accurate cost assessments.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
